原创 学习Extjs与RoR的集成有感收藏

新一篇: 放弃完美的需求管理 | 旧一篇: 配置管理计划的新设想

 今天除了跟两个项目的负责人讨论他们的开发过程改进外,其余时间就是在学习Extjs,对我来讲,最好的办法,就是在PPA系统中中应用它们,幸好,Extjs现在已经可以与RoR应用集成在一起了。
看了一个伙计录的Extjs的教程,里面的浏览器的地址栏中的端口是3000,不用说应该是RoR的应用了,里面的界面设计很新颖,连忙发给drift看,得到感叹若干。
经过一番努力,tree,grid和menu已经加入到了PPA系统中,忽然感觉这种编程方式好熟悉啊,仔细想想,用VC定义菜单和事件处理时,不就是这么做的吗?toolbar,Menu,MenuItem定义完,会形成一个资源文件,其内容跟现在的literal有多大的区别?
又在梁的推荐下安装了IE spector,运行例子时,去看tree的Dom结构,这才意识到,要想用js在浏览器中画出一棵树来,真不是件容易事啊。一个典型点的树节点,大约需要5-6个span或者div才能完成,一棵树下来,就会有一堆的span或者div,这么多频繁而琐碎的dom操作难怪性能要比taglib慢呢。
由上面的两点,联想到了若干年前的MFC框架,以及ATL,不知道还有多少人在用它们,Ajax流行后,大家好像越来越开始怀念Win32程序,结果个浏览器中画出了形形色色的widgets,难道这就是BS的最终命运吗?
 
 
 

发表于 @ 2007年05月10日 22:25:00|评论(loading...)|编辑

新一篇: 放弃完美的需求管理 | 旧一篇: 配置管理计划的新设想

评论

#sp42 发表于2007-08-16 13:01:04  IP: 219.136.11.*
EXT中文站
#tianyubing 发表于2007-09-15 15:19:15  IP: 222.129.32.*
从BS开发的富客户,如果使用目前的代码量来说,远远不如delphi和Vb开发,如果采用delphi,vb使用webservice的方案可能更加实际,尤其是delphi和Vb开发ActiveX放在html来使用,它的交互性,美观,也特别合适,随着继续发展,比如Extjs的designer如果出现将会真正让他们转为实用,甚至取代CS的设计方式,Adobe的Air开发桌面应用已经指出了这个方向。
#furniture 发表于2007-11-05 15:34:36  IP: 218.18.56.*
顶一下
发表评论  


当前用户设置只有注册用户才能发表评论。如果你没有登录,请点击登录
Csdn Blog version 3.1a
Copyright © 豆豆他爹